在数字货币和区块链应用迅速发展的今天,MetaMask成为了数百万用户的首选加密钱包和以太坊区块链的连接工具。用户可以通过MetaMask轻松地访问去中心化应用(DApp),并进行数字资产的管理与交易。但有时用户会遇到MetaMask没有变化或未更新的情况,这可能导致用户在使用DApp时感到困惑和挫折。本文将深入探讨这一问题,并为用户提供可能的解决方案。
MetaMask未变化的常见原因
当MetaMask未变化时,首先需要明确其具体方面。例如,用户可能在查看余额时没有更新,也可能在进行交易后未能看到状态变化。以下是一些可能导致MetaMask未变化的常见原因:
1. **网络问题**:MetaMask依赖于以太坊网络或其他连接的区块链,如果网络出现故障,用户的余额或交易状态可能无法及时更新。 2. **浏览器缓存**:有时浏览器缓存会导致MetaMask显示过时的信息。浏览器在加载页面时可能从缓存中读取旧的数据,而不是从MetaMask或以太坊网络获取最新的信息。 3. **签名未完成**:在进行交易时,如果用户没有完成签名,交易不会被提交到区块链,MetaMask不会显示相关的变化。 4. **钱包设置问题**:某些特定的设置,如网络选择不当(例如连接到错误的主网或测试网),可能导致MetaMask无法正常显示最新的余额或交易信息。如何解决MetaMask未变化的问题
检查网络连接
首先,用户应检查他们的以太坊网络连接。MetaMask支持多个以太坊网络,例如主网、Ropsten测试网和Kovan测试网。确保用户选择了正确的网络,并且该网络正在正常运行。可以通过访问以太坊区块链浏览器(如Etherscan)来确认网络状态。
清除浏览器缓存
如果网络没有问题,用户可以尝试清除浏览器缓存。清除缓存后,重新加载MetaMask扩展程序,这通常能解决显示未更新的信息的问题。用户可以在浏览器设置中找到清除缓存的选项。请注意,清除缓存不会删除用户在MetaMask中的任何资产或信息。
检查交易签名状态
在进行交易时,务必确保所有步骤已完成,包括签名。如果交易在MetaMask中显示为待确认状态,用户可以查看相关的通知。用户还可以在MetaMask的活动记录中查找交易状态。若有必要,用户可以选择撤销未完成的交易。
更改钱包设置
如果前面的步骤都未能解决问题,用户可能需要检查MetaMask的设置。用户可以通过点击应用程序右上角的个人头像,选择“设置”进行调整。确保用户已选择正确的加密网络,如以太坊主网,并进行相应的更新。
相关问题探讨
1. 如何确保MetaMask安全?
安全是使用任何加密钱包时最重要的考虑因素。MetaMask作为一个热门的加密钱包,自然成为了黑客的重点攻击目标。因此,用户需要采取一系列措施来确保他们的钱包安全:
1. **使用强密码**:为MetaMask创建一个强密码,确保密码的复杂性,不使用易于猜测的字词或数字。 2. **二次验证**:虽然MetaMask本身不支持二次验证,但用户可以通过加强设备的安全性(如启用操作系统的二次验证机制)来提高安全性。 3. **备份助记词**:在创建钱包时,MetaMask会生成一组助记词,用户需要妥善保存这组词。一旦丢失,用户将无法访问他们的钱包。 4. **定期更新**:保持MetaMask及其浏览器的最新版本,修复可能的安全漏洞。 5. **警惕钓鱼网站**:避免访问未经验证的链接或网站,尤其是在输入助记词或密码时。2. MetaMask与其他加密钱包的对比
市场上有很多不同的加密钱包,MetaMask只是其中一个。以下是MetaMask与其他主流加密钱包的对比:
1. **功能性**:MetaMask是一个跨浏览器扩展,支持访问各种DApp,功能相对丰富。相较于Cold Wallet(冷钱包),MetaMask更方便,但其安全性稍逊。 2. **使用便捷性**:MetaMask的用户界面友好,易于上手,非常适合初学者。因此,与其他需要更复杂操作的钱包(如硬件钱包)相比,更具有便捷性。 3. **支持的资产**:MetaMask主要支持以太坊和ERC-20代币,而其他钱包(如Trust Wallet)可能支持更多种类的资产。 4. **安全性**:MetaMask的安全性较高,但相对硬件钱包来说仍是热钱包,容易受到网络攻击。相比之下,冷钱包则是离线储存,安全风险更低。根据用户的需求,可以选择不同类型的钱包。3. 使用MetaMask时常见错误及其解决方案
使用MetaMask时,用户可能会遇到一些常见的错误,了解这些错误及其解决方案可以帮助用户更高效地解决
1. **钱包连接失败**:当用户尝试连接DApp时,可能会遇到连接失败的情况。用户需要检查是否已成功安装MetaMask扩展,并返回到DApp重新连接。 2. **无法发送交易**:当用户尝试发送交易时,可能会遇到“HARDWALLET_ERROR”消息,通常由于网络不稳定或用户账户余额不足。解决方法包括检查网络状态和确保余额充足。 3. **交易无法确认**:如果交易在MetaMask中显示为“Pending”,而在网络上又没有确认,用户可以竞争提高Gas费,通常能加快交易的确认时间。 4. **导入失败**:如果用户尝试导入钱包却出现错误,通常是助记词错误或网络不稳定。建议用户核对助记词或重启MetaMask进行尝试。4. 如何使用MetaMask进行交易?
用户如果希望开始在MetaMask中进行交易,需要掌握一些基本流程:
1. **连接钱包**:用户首先需要在浏览器中打开MetaMask扩展,并确保其已解锁。然后在支持的DApp中,选择通过MetaMask连接。 2. **选择资产**:用户在DApp中选择需要交易的资产,如以太币(ETH)或其他代币。 3. **输入金额**:用户需输入欲交易的金额,并观察系统显示的预计Gas费。 4. **确认交易**:在所有信息无误的情况下,用户可以点击“确认”按钮,MetaMask将自动处理交易。 5. **查看状态**:交易确认后,用户可以通过区块链浏览器跟踪交易的状态,确认其是否成功。通过以上的介绍,相信用户对MetaMask未变化的问题有了全面的认识,以及如何解决相关问题。随着加密货币行业的持续发展,保持对工具的学习与应用是每个用户迈向成功的关键。
